Movable structure of stair formwork

By designing a movable structure for the staircase formwork, the problems of fixed dimensions and inconvenient cleaning of traditional aluminum alloy formwork were solved, enabling flexible adjustment and efficient cleaning, thus improving construction efficiency and safety.

Technical Field

[0001] This utility model relates to the field of building formwork technology, specifically a movable structure for stair formwork. Background Technology

[0002] In modern construction engineering, stairs are a core component connecting different floors, and their construction quality and aesthetics directly affect the overall quality of the building. Stair formwork, as a key tool in stair construction, is of paramount importance.

[0003] Aluminum alloy formwork is widely used in formwork support for building construction projects due to its excellent forming effect and lightweight characteristics.

[0004] Traditional aluminum alloy stair formwork has a fixed size and cannot be adjusted to accommodate different stair sizes in various buildings. It requires pre-cutting of staircases of different sizes for each building, resulting in a large initial investment and a long processing cycle. In addition, the surface of the aluminum formwork at the bottom of the staircase is smooth, and the steel reinforcement protective layer spacers need to be tied to the steel reinforcement one by one, which causes inconvenience to the workers.

[0005] Furthermore, the existing enclosed staircase formwork structure makes it inconvenient to clean up construction debris after the steel reinforcement is laid, requiring the use of specialized machinery for cleaning, which results in low cleaning efficiency. Utility Model Content

[0006] To address the shortcomings of existing technologies, this utility model provides a movable stair formwork structure, which solves the problems of fixed dimensions, poor adjustability, high initial investment, difficulty in fixing concrete pads on the bottom of the staircase, and difficulty in cleaning up construction waste in traditional stair formwork.

[0029] In the specific implementation process, it is worth noting that this case does not have one side of the side plate 2 directly attached to the wall. The width of the stair treads can be changed by adjusting the position between the vertical plate 5 and the horizontal plate 4. The first threaded rod 6 and the fourth threaded rod 19 can fix the horizontal plate 4 and the vertical plate 5.

[0030] Furthermore, the outer wall of the side plate 2 is fixedly connected with a reinforcing block 8 by bolts, and the outer wall of the reinforcing block 8 fits into the groove 7. The bottom of the base plate 1 is provided with a reinforcing rib 9.

[0031] In the specific implementation process, it is worth noting that the reinforcing block 8 can improve the strength of the side plate 2 itself and avoid the deformation and damage of the side plate 2 during casting, while the reinforcing rib 9 can improve the strength of the bottom plate 1.

[0032] Furthermore, a pad 10 is attached to the top of the base plate 1, and a second threaded rod 11 is threadedly connected to the inner wall of the pad 10. The outer wall of the second threaded rod 11 is threadedly connected to the inner wall of the base plate 1, and a first nut 12 is threadedly connected to the outer wall of the second threaded rod 11. The outer wall of the first nut 12 is pressed against the bottom of the base plate 1.

[0033] In the specific implementation process, it is worth noting that the workers can use the spacer 10 to carry out the pre-embedding of the steel bars, and after the pouring is completed, the steel bars will not be directly exposed, thus avoiding the phenomenon of steel bar corrosion. After the pouring is completed, the second threaded rod 11 can be removed, and the first nut 12 can improve the stability of the spacer 10.

[0034] Specifically, when using this movable structure of staircase formwork, the workers first erect the base plate 1 on one side of the wall, then install the pad 10, the second threaded rod 11 and the first nut 12, and then pre-embed the reinforcing bars through the pad 10. After that, the side plate 2 is connected and fixed to the base plate 1, and then the horizontal plate 4 and the vertical plate 5 are installed. After all the installations are completed, the pouring operation can be carried out.

[0035] Example 2: From Figure 1 , 2 As can be seen from 4, a curved plate 13 is rotatably connected to the bottom of the base plate 1, a cover plate 14 is attached to the outer wall of the curved plate 13, a first support plate 18 is rotatably connected to the top of the cover plate 14, a second support plate 15 is attached to the bottom of the vertical plate 5 located below, and the top side of the second support plate 15 is threadedly connected to the outer wall of the fourth threaded rod 19 located below.

[0036] In the specific implementation process, it is worth noting that there is a building mold for the stair platform between the second support plate 15 and the first support plate 18, and a building mold for the load-bearing beam between the curved plate 13 and the cover plate 14. When the stair platform is poured, the stair platform and the load-bearing beam can be poured together. When the pouring is not carried out, the construction waste can be collected for easier cleaning.

[0037] Furthermore, a third threaded rod 17 is pressed against the outer wall of the cover plate 14, and an inclined tube 16 is threadedly connected to the outer wall of the third threaded rod 17. The end of the inclined tube 16 is fixedly connected to the bottom of the first support plate 18.

[0038] In the specific implementation process, it is worth noting that the cooperation between the third threaded rod 17 and the inclined tube 16 can limit the cover plate 14 and prevent the cover plate 14 from opening accidentally.

[0039] Specifically, based on the above embodiment 1, when it is necessary to remove the garbage inside the curved plate 13, the worker twists the third threaded rod 17. At this time, the third threaded rod 17 moves along the inner wall of the inclined tube 16. When the third threaded rod 17 moves away from the cover plate 14 by a certain distance, the cover plate 14 can be opened, and then the cleaning work can be carried out.
